Which leadership arena is most focused on immediate, on-the-spot interactions with team members?

The tactical leadership arena is centered on immediate, on-the-spot interactions and actions involving team members. This type of leadership is essential in situations that require quick decision-making and direct problem-solving. In the tactical arena, leaders need to respond rapidly to challenges, providing guidance and support as circumstances unfold. This often involves coordinating efforts, managing team dynamics, and ensuring that each member is effectively contributing to the task at hand.

In contrast, the strategic arena is more about long-term planning and overarching goals, while the operational arena deals with the implementation of strategies, focusing on processes and workflows. Administrative leadership revolves around governance, policies, and adherence to regulations, which typically do not require the immediacy of interactions that characterize tactical leadership. Thus, the tactical leadership arena is distinctly aligned with the need for real-time engagement and responsiveness among team members.
